Close to perfect?
After buying a few sets of [color] flash cards, I finally found this set that has easy to read and has examples of that color on each card, and have more than just red, blue, and yellow. The only downside to the cards is they each have a hole punched in them and are held together with a metal ring. Flipping through them is cumbersome and the holes compromise the durability of the cards, especially when kiddos like to throw things across the room.All in all, better than other sets I've used.

Not the sellers fault but not able to use them as hoping
It favors English sports and also uses the English word for the name of the sport. In all fairness the description notes that it is English but many people may not realize they mean English as in England not English as in language. I honestly knew it meant English as in England but didn’t realize how different American English is to England English. Cards like this make the differences more apparent and obvious. Not a huge deal but considering why I ordered these it’s a little frustrating. My son has a language delay so I use these to help him communicate. The sports cards aren’t really used at this time due to what I noted and his age (obviously not the sellers fault).

Good variety and clear pictures
My son loves these. He has apraxia and we work on pronunciation as often as possible. These cards have many of his favorite foods in them and he happily goes over all the cards several times a day and when he gets too worked up to talk he has the card to show me while he calms down. He’s even been sleeping with his cards and they seem to be holding up well.
